The UPS Foundation awards eighteen grants in the amount of more than $5.5 million to nonprofit groups that promote community safety through urgent humanitarian relief efforts and road safety initiatives.
The UPS Foundation works with non-profits in the humanitarian relief space to enhance their ability to prepare and respond to natural disasters and also creates innovative community safety partnerships with nonprofits for road safety.
